WebApr 4, 2024 · How to apply for food stamps (SNAP benefits) Known previously as "food stamps," the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program (SNAP) can help you pay for food if you have a low income. Each month, SNAP benefits are added to an electronic benefit transfer (EBT) card to use when you shop for food. WebOn November 16, 2024, the Advisory Council to Support Grandparents Raising Grandchildren released its initial report to Congress. This report outlines the joys, challenges, gaps, and unmet needs faced by kin and grandparent caregivers. WebFinancial Assistance. We can connect residents to short-term and long-term financial assistance. We partner with community groups and nonprofit organizations to provide credit counseling, food aid and foreclosure prevention programs. We also help first-time homebuyers with down payment assistance. WebThese plans describe Connecticut’s programs that furnish financial assistance and services to needy families in a manner to fulfill the purposes of the Temporary Assistance for Needy Families (TANF) program. Temporary Family Assistance - TFA TFA is a cash assistance program for basic and special needs which are paid to recipients of Jobs First.
